HB 887 Maryland House of Delegates · 2026 Regular Session

Video Lottery Terminals - Distribution of Local Impact Grants - Allocation for Fair Hill Purses

HB 887 requires that for fiscal years 2027 through 2029, $200,000 of the local impact grants distributed to Cecil County from video lottery terminal proceeds must be allocated for prize money at races held at the Fair Hill Natural Resources Management Area. This bill directly affects Cecil County and the Fair Hill facility, as it mandates a specific use of a portion of the county's video lottery funds. The change modifies existing state law to direct these funds toward local racing events at Fair Hill, rather than allowing general county use. The bill takes effect on July 1, 2026.
